Hi kjb85;

Yes i have it--- has your neuro got down to the root cause? There is a reason...thyroid,glucose pre-diabtes or post,sarcoidosis and other things. Mine after a skin biopsy I had many test ran --turned out was my thryoid. It took awhile to get thyroid in control with meds but once I did symptoms got 80 to 90% better and less frequent. Has anyone in your family been diagnosed? Let me know if you have any ?.
